PERU

REGION: San Martin De Pangoa

PROCESS: Washed 

VARIETY: Catimor 

ALTITUDE: 820-1650 MASL

Located to the East of the Andes mountain range, in the region of Junin in Peru, the San Martin De Pangoa area has been growing unique and high quality coffee since the 1980’s.

Bordering the Peruvian Amazon, the farmers here have a focus on organic, sustainable, and fair trade farming standards, which allows for high quality coffee and cacao to be grown. Honey is also farmed here, meaning a strong bee population, along with a diverse ecology, aids reforestation and soil enrichment.

Coffees from this region tend to have a medium body with smooth chocolate and brown sugar notes, floral aromatics and a mild berry acidity.
